A married couple lost their attempt to reverse a $511,000 agreement they made with the IRS that had settled their failure to report their Swiss bank account holdings when a D.C. federal judge ruled they had entered into it voluntarily.

A Virginia couple seeking to recover penalties for unreported offshore bank information told a D.C. federal court Wednesday the IRS violated administrative law when it didn't provide guidance for individuals who want to transition into a more lenient disclosure program.

A Virginia couple told a D.C. federal court they wrongly paid over $500,000 in foreign bank account reporting taxes and penalties after the IRS arbitrarily rejected their transfer request from the Offshore Voluntary Disclosure Program to a more favorable program.
